About Mora Chengelijan Village
Mora Chengelijan is a mid sized village in Helem tehsil, in the district of Sonitpur, Assam.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 882, made up of 441 males and 441 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,000 females per 1000 males. The village covers 220.99 hectares hectares.

Getting to Mora Chengelijan
The census records public bus service for Mora Chengelijan as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
